在第一次授精的第5和第6天,从183头超排供体共回收到691枚正常胚胎,并检查其形态和大小与发育阶段的关系。合子、2、4、8和16细胞胚胎和桑椹胚的透明带厚度、内细胞团的直径、胚胎的总直径(Overall diameter)无显著差异。然而,在囊胚期,内细胞团的直径、胚胎总直径显著增加,透明带显著薄于早期胚胎,从合子到桑堪胚,分裂球数目增加,分裂球体积显著降低。2细胞胚胎的内细胞团体积较合子降低了30%,而从2细胞到桑椹胚,内细胞团的体积没有增加。第一次授精后第6天回收的桑椹胚的总直径及内细胞团的直径显著高于第5天回收的桑椹胚。
A total of 691 normal embryos were retrieved from 183 superovulation donors on the 5th and 6th day of the first insemination and the relationship between their morphology and size and developmental stages was examined. Zona, 2, 4, 8 and 16 cell embryos and morula zona pellucida thickness, inner cell mass diameter, embryo diameter (Overall diameter) no significant difference. However, at the blastocyst stage, the diameter of the inner cell mass and the total diameter of the embryo increased significantly, and the zona pellucida was significantly thinner than that of the early embryo. From zygote to sancock embryos, the number of dividing spheres increased and the volume of the spherule decreased significantly. The intracellular volume of 2-cell embryos was 30% less than that of zygotes, whereas there was no increase in the volume of inner cell mass from 2 cells to morula. The total diameter of the morula and the size of the inner cell mass recovered on the 6th day after the first insemination were significantly higher than those of the morula recovered on the 5th day.
